I do get mine colored. When my hairloss started, I'd stopped for a while, in case it was a factor, but it made no difference in what I was losing. I did switch salon's, and they now use Goldwell color . It makes my hair shinier, which is a huge help. My hair is very dark naturally, and I get it colored about the same shade, maybe a teeny bit darker. I'm mostly trying to cover the grays, but I like the texture of my hair better for a few weeks after the color is done. In my case, I see no difference in how much hair I lose right after I have it done or several weeks later. The day it's done is another story...
